Overview of ChampionX Corporation
ChampionX is a leading provider of chemicals and services essential to oil and gas operations. The company prides itself on developing advanced solutions that enhance oilfield productivity. The Class Action Lawsuit
At the heart of the current crisis is a class-action lawsuit stemming from allegations that ChampionX failed to disclose crucial information about stock repurchases during a critical acquisition phase. Specifically, between February 29, 2024, and April 1, 2024, ChampionX reportedly repurchased shares while potentially knowing about an impending offer from Schlumberger, which was considerably higher than the market price at the time. According to the complaint, the company received an unsolicited offer of $36.70 per share and subsequently a raised offer of $37.80 per share. At the same time, ChampionX’s average stock price hovered around $33.32 during this period. This discrepancy suggests a troubling lack of transparency, as investors were allegedly misled about the true value of their investments.
